S T A T E O F N E W Y O R K ________________________________________________________________________ 9668 I N A S S E M B L Y March 28, 2022 ___________ Introduced by M. of A. ABBATE -- read once and referred to the Committee on Governmental Employees AN ACT to amend the retirement and social security law, in relation to investments by public pension funds TH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F NEW YORK, REPRESENTED IN SENATE AND ASSEM- BLY, DO ENACT AS FOLLOWS: Section 1. Subdivision 8 and paragraph (a) of subdivision 9 of section 177 of the retirement and social security law, subdivision 8 as amended by chapter 594 of the laws of 1993, and paragraph (a) of subdivision 9 as amended by chapter 22 of the laws of 2006, are amended to read as follows: 8. The trustees of a fund shall have the power to invest the moneys thereof in foreign equity securities provided that (a) any such equity security is registered on a national securities exchange, as provided in an act of congress of the United States, entitled the "Securities Exchange Act of 1934", approved June sixth, nineteen hundred thirty- four, as amended, or otherwise registered pursuant to said act and, if such equity security is so otherwise registered, price quotations there- for are furnished through a nationwide automated quotation system approved by the National Association of Securities Dealers, Inc. or is registered on a foreign exchange organized and regulated pursuant to the laws of the jurisdiction of such exchange and (b) the corporation has averaged at least one billion dollars in annual sales for the three consecutive years preceding the year in which the investment is made or has market capitalization of at least one billion dollars at the time the investment is made. Investments in such foreign equities shall be included together with a fund's investments in other equity securities for purposes of the percentage limitations set forth in the foregoing subdivisions of this section, and not more than [ten] THIRTY per centum of the assets of any fund shall be invested in the aggregate in such foreign equities. (a) the investments by a fund made pursuant to this subdivision shall not at any time exceed [twenty-five] THIRTY-FIVE per centum of the assets of such fund; EXPLANATION--Matter in ITALICS (underscored) is new; matter in brackets [ ] is old law to be omitted.

S T A T E O F N E W Y O R K ________________________________________________________________________ 9668--A I N A S S E M B L Y March 28, 2022 ___________ Introduced by M. of A. ABBATE -- read once and referred to the Committee on Governmental Employees -- committee discharged, bill amended, ordered reprinted as amended and recommitted to said committee AN ACT to amend the retirement and social security law, in relation to investments by public pension funds TH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F NEW YORK, REPRESENTED IN SENATE AND ASSEM- BLY, DO ENACT AS FOLLOWS: Section 1. Paragraph (a) of subdivision 9 of section 177 of the retirement and social security law, as amended by chapter 22 of the laws of 2006, is amended to read as follows: (a) the investments by a fund made pursuant to this subdivision shall not at any time exceed [twenty-five] THIRTY-FIVE per centum of the assets of such fund; § 2. This act shall take effect immediately. FISCAL NOTE.--Pursuant to Legislative Law, Section 50: This bill would amend subdivision 9 of Section 177 of the Retirement and Social Security Law to increase to 35% the percentage of assets which may be invested by the New York State Teachers' Retirement System in those investments that aren't otherwise specifically permitted under the other subdivisions of this section. The current limit is 25%. If this bill is enacted, any cost or savings to the employers of members of the New York State Teachers' Retirement System would depend on the investment performance of any assets that are invested in a different manner due to this change in the investment restrictions. Additional investment income will result in lower required employer contributions, and vice-versa.
